ip dhcp client class-id

ip dhcp restart client

This command specifies the DCHP client vendor class identifier for the current
interface. Use the no form to remove the class identifier from the DHCP packet.
Syntax
ip dhcp client class-id [text text | hex hex]
no ip dhcp client class-id
text - A text string. (Range: 1-32 characters)
hex - A hexadecimal value. (Range: 1-64 characters)
Default Setting
Class identifier option enabled, with the name Motorola Solutions Inc.
Command Mode
Interface Configuration (VLAN)
Command Usage
Use this command without a keyword to restore the default setting.
This command is used to identify the vendor class and configuration of the
switch to the DHCP server, which then uses this information to decide on how
to service the client or the type of information to return.
The general framework for this DHCP option is set out in RFC 2132 (Option 60).
This information is used to convey configuration settings or other identification
information about a client, but the specific string to use should be supplied by
your service provider or network administrator.
The server should reply with Option 66 attributes, including the TFTP server
name and boot file name.
Example
Console(config)#interface vlan 2
Console(config-if)#ip dhcp client class-id hex 0000e8666572
Console(config-if)#
